TRW’s Range of Steel Handlebar Types and Heights

Motorbikes are equipped as standard with generic handlebars. This means they are not optimally suited to every rider. Body size, the proportions between leg and arm length, the preferred seating position, different riding styles and many other very individual characteristics cannot be combined in a generic handlebar. TRW’s range of handlebar types and heights mean personal adjustments can be made, improving rider comfort and experience.

ZF TRW steel handlebar

Rider handling can also be noticeably positively influenced by changing the handlebars:

  • A higher/stronger cranked handlebar enables a more upright seating position, which can relieve strain on long distances and thus promotes a more ergonomically pleasant and comfortable ride. Such a conversion is suitable for touring, sport-touring, off-road, travel, chopper, pleasure riders, tall riders and many others.
  • A low/only slightly cranked handlebar shifts the rider’s upper body forward and increases the front wheel load. This reduces the risk of the bike lifting off when accelerating hard, and the feeling for the road becomes more intense. Sporty, active riders like to choose such flatter handlebars.
  • Wider handlebars literally give the rider a longer lever to initiate steering movements. This makes heavy machines more manageable and can increase riding enjoyment and safety. The riding position can also be made more casual.
